In standard particle swarm optimization (PSO), the velocity only provides a position displacement contrast with the longer computational time. To avoid premature convergence, a new modified PSO is proposed in which the velocity considered as a predictor, while the position considered as a corrector. The algorithm gives some balance between global and local search capability, and results the high computational efficiency. The optimization computing of some examples is made to show the new algorithm has better global search capacity and rapid convergence rate.
